Roadside bomb wounds 4 in SE Turkey, security sources say
By REUTERS
ISTANBUL - A roadside bomb, believed to have been planted by Kurdish militants, wounded four civilians in southeast Turkey on Sunday, security sources said.The victims' car struck the bomb on the road between Sirnak and Cizre, a town close to Turkey's border with Iraq and Syria.
